i3g的CPU物理核心数与线程数取值表 实例规格 默认vCPU数 CPU物理核心数取值范围 每核线程数默认值 每核线程数取值范围 ecs.i3g.2xlarge 8 2、4 2 1、2 ecs.i3g.4xlarge 16 2、4、6、8 2 1、2 ecs.i3g.8xlarge 32 2、4、6、8、10、12、14、...
线程分析功能提供线程粒度的CPU耗时和每类线程数量的统计,并且每5分钟记录一次线程的方法栈并聚合,可真实还原代码执行过程,帮助您快速定位线程问题。当发现集群的CPU使用率过高,或者出现大量慢方法时,可以通过线程分析功能找到消耗CPU...
c7a的CPU物理核心数与线程数取值表 实例规格 默认vCPU数 CPU物理核心数取值范围 每核线程数默认值 每核线程数取值范围 ecs.c7a.large 2 1 2 1、2 ecs.c7a.xlarge 4 2 2 1、2 ecs.c7a.2xlarge 8 2、4 2 1、2 ecs.c7a.4xlarge 16 2、4、6、8 ...
g7a的CPU物理核心数与线程数取值表 实例规格 默认vCPU数 CPU物理核心数取值范围 每核线程数默认值 每核线程数取值范围 ecs.g7a.large 2 1 2 1、2 ecs.g7a.xlarge 4 2 2 1、2 ecs.g7a.2xlarge 8 2、4 2 1、2 ecs.g7a.4xlarge 16 2、4、6、8 ...
r7a的CPU物理核心数与线程数取值表 实例规格 默认vCPU数 CPU物理核心数取值范围 每核线程数默认值 每核线程数取值范围 ecs.r7a.large 2 1 2 1、2 ecs.r7a.xlarge 4 2 2 1、2 ecs.r7a.2xlarge 8 2、4 2 1、2 ecs.r7a.4xlarge 16 2、4、6、8 ...
hfg7的CPU物理核心数与线程数取值表 实例规格 默认vCPU数 CPU物理核心数取值范围 每核线程数默认值 每核线程数取值范围 ecs.hfg7.large 2 1 2 1、2 ecs.hfg7.xlarge 4 2 2 1、2 ecs.hfg7.2xlarge 8 2、4 2 1、2 ecs.hfg7.3xlarge 12 2、4、...
getThreadPool:获取一个执行该任务的线程池,如果没有设置,会使用客户端自带的线程池。getName:获取这个执行器的名字。客户端接收到任务的触发请求时,会根据名字寻找匹配的执行器。说明 当任务需要按多个步骤执行时,需要写多个实现类...
线程分析功能提供线程粒度的CPU耗时和每类线程数量的统计,并且每5分钟记录一次线程的方法栈并聚合,可真实还原代码执行过程,帮助您快速定位线程问题。当发现集群的CPU使用率过高,或者出现大量慢方法时,可以通过线程分析功能找到消耗CPU...
本文介绍如何排查Nacos线程数过多的问题。问题现象 通过监控系统或其他手段,观察到应用的线程数过多,且大部分线程名中带有nacos等字样。可能原因 系统环境问题。程序读取到的CPU数量错误,导致线程池核心大小和最大大小过大。应用中创建...
线程分析功能提供线程粒度的CPU耗时和每类线程数量的统计,并且每5分钟记录一次线程的方法栈并聚合,可真实还原代码执行过程,帮助您快速定位线程问题。当发现集群的CPU使用率过高,或者出现大量慢方法时,可以通过线程分析功能找到消耗CPU...
设置异步线程池大小及任务队列的大小,还有无数据线程休眠时间 puller.setConsumeMinThreadSize(6);puller.setConsumeMaxThreadSize(16);puller.setThreadQueueSize(200);puller.setPullMsgThreadSize(1);和服务端联调问题时开启,平时无需...
本文介绍在MDL系统中常用的数据结构及含义,从实现角度讨论MDL的获取机制与死锁检测,分享在实践中如何监控MDL状态。背景信息 为了满足数据库在并发请求下的事务隔离性和一致性要求,同时针对MySQL插件式多种存储引擎都能发挥作用,MySQL在...
将Agent线程池设置为static final类型,方便获取线程池归属。Agent没有开启MSE的情况下,MSE逻辑不执行。流量防护两种WebInterceptor的资源名默认与行为对齐,接口名包括 context-path 前缀。微服务治理洞察功能不再上报数据到服务端,...
UDP 550 无法打开socket(通常是因为系统资源耗尽)UDP 611 连接失败(host无法解析)UDP 610 发送或接收失败 UDP 615 内容不匹配 DNS 610 DNS解析失败 DNS 613 DNS query通信出现异常 DNS 615 内容不匹配 健康检查恢复 当健康检查发现地址...
您可以查看运行中作业的性能,包括Job Manager与运行Task Managers的CPU、内存和线程的使用情况,这可以协助您定位代码问题,例如作业代码是否存在问题、个别类是否初始化比较慢、个别类是否占用资源比较多等问题。本文为您介绍如何查看...
其他方法不受影响,还是以服务端配置为准(单位ms)int-1 corePoolSize 否 单独针对这个服务设置最小活跃线程数,从公用线程池中划分出来 int 0 maxPoolSize 否 单独针对这个服务设置最大活跃线程数,从公用线程池中划分出来 int 0 ...
其他方法不受影响,还是以服务端配置为准(单位ms)int-1 corePoolSize 否 单独针对这个服务设置最小活跃线程数,从公用线程池中划分出来 int 0 maxPoolSize 否 单独针对这个服务设置最大活跃线程数,从公用线程池中划分出来 int 0 ...
什么是告警日志 告警日志是GTM 针对健康检查报警/恢复、地址池集合不可用/恢复、主备地址池切换等行为记录的日志信息。功能说明 健康检查报警 当健康检查发现地址池集合中的地址出现异常时,会记录在日志信息里。记录内容包括:异常时间、...
每个缓存池管理其自己的空闲列表、刷新列表、LRUs和所有与缓存池连接的其他数据结构,并由其自己的缓存池互斥量进行保护。innodb_buffer_pool_load_at_startup 5.6 0 OFF[ON|OFF]无限制 指定在MySQL服务器启动时,通过加载之前保存在InnoDB...
在完全兼容开源Elasticsearch(ES)内核的所有特性基础上,阿里云ES在监控指标多样化、线程池、熔断策略优化、查询与写入性能优化等诸多方面,深度定制了AliES内核引擎。基于阿里云Elasticsearch团队在多种应用场景下所积累的丰富经验,...
线程池支持的框架 线程池监控支持Tomcat、HSF、Dubbo、Vert.x和Undertow1.x框架,采集的指标如下:指标名称 指标 线程池核心线程数 arms_threadpool_core_size 线程池最大线程数 arms_threadpool_max_size 线程池活跃线程数 arms_...
而线程池大小的配置则可以在系统运行期间连续多次变更,称之为动态配置。配置管理 在数据中心中,系统中所有配置的编辑、存储、分发、变更管理、历史版本管理、变更审计等所有与配置相关的活动统称为配置管理。配置推送 配置管理中,常需要...
另外,由于不同的通信模组上的OS不同,所以与通信模组上TCP相关的操作也被定义成HAL函数需要客户进行实现。所有HAL函数位于文件为output/eng/wrappers/wrapper.c中。系统相关HAL 必须实现函数:*函数名 说明 1 HAL_Malloc 对应标准C库中的...
文档目标 下面的文档关注于讲解用户如何把SDK移植到MCU,并与通信模组协作来与阿里云物联网平台通信。为了简化移植过程,下面的文档在MCU上以开发一个基础版产品作为案例进行讲解,+如果用户需要在MCU上使用SDK的其它功能,可以在MCU上将...
通过阿里云会话管理免密登录:会话管理客户端与云助手服务端、云助手服务端与云助手Agent之间通信时,会通过WSS(Web Socket Secure)协议建立WebSocket长连接。WSS使用SSL(Secure Socket Layer)加密WebSocket长连接,能够保障数据的安全...
本地通信功能 函数名 是否必选 说明 HAL_UDP_create_without_connect 否 创建一个本地UDP Socket,但不发起任何网络交互。HAL_UDP_close_without_connect 否 销毁指定的UDP Socket,回收资源。HAL_UDP_joinmulticast 否 在指定的UDP Socket...
本文介绍访问 云原生内存数据库Tair 与 云数据库Redis版 时的常见报错与解决方法。报错概览 分类 报错项 Redis通用异常 ERR illegal address ERR sentinel compatibility mode is disabled ERR max number of clients reached NOAUTH ...
本文介绍访问 云原生内存数据库Tair 与 云数据库Redis版 时的常见报错与解决方法。报错概览 分类 报错项 Redis通用异常 ERR illegal address ERR sentinel compatibility mode is disabled ERR max number of clients reached NOAUTH ...
由于自适应扫描线程与各个PX worker进程之间的通信数据很少,频率不高,所以重用了已有的QC进程与PX worker进程之间的libpq连接进行报文通信。自适应扫描线程通过poll的方式在需要时同步轮询PX Worker进程的请求和响应。扫描任务协调。PX ...
E44 Enclave调试输出连接建立失败 Enclave CLI无法与指定Enclave的调试输出串口建立通信连接,请确保该Enclave在调试模式下运行。E45 Enclave调试输出获取失败 Enclave CLI无法获取Enclave调试输出,可尝试重新运行命令。E46 Enclave调试...
heartbeatIntervalMs false Intege 心跳检测超时时间 retryHeartbeatTimes false Intege 心跳检测重试次数 retryConnectTimes false Intege 连接建立重试次数 coreThreadPoolSize false Intege 核心线程池的大小,会影响netty中线程池,...
executor-设置自定义线程池。timeout-设置服务端执行超时时间。单位:毫秒 超时后不会打断执行线程,只是打印警告。concurrents-设置接口下每个方法的最大可并行执行请求数,取值如下:1:关闭并发过滤器。0:开启过滤,但不限制并发执行...
StartWorkThread 3.1.9 启动工作线程数,默认1即启动一个线程,若-1则启动CPU核数的线程数。在高并发的情况下建议选择4。这一接口有初始化NlsClient的作用。ReleaseInstance 3.1.9 销毁NlsClient对象实例,即释放NLS SDK。此操作需要在销毁...
StartWorkThread 3.1.9 启动工作线程数,默认1即启动一个线程,若-1则启动CPU核数的线程数。在高并发的情况下建议选择-1。这一接口有初始化NlsClient的作用。ReleaseInstance 3.1.9 销毁NlsClient对象实例,即释放NLS SDK。此操作需要在...
StartWorkThread 3.1.9 启动工作线程数,默认1即启动一个线程,若-1则启动CPU核数的线程数。在高并发的情况下建议选择-1。这一接口有初始化NlsClient的作用。ReleaseInstance 3.1.9 销毁NlsClient对象实例,即释放NLS SDK。此操作需要在...
NetACC利用eRDMA的低时延、高吞吐、内核旁路、协议栈卸载等优势,通过兼容socket接口,实现对现有TCP应用的加速效果。本文为您介绍NetACC的功能、应用场景以及如何使用NetACC。重要 NetACC当前处于公测阶段。应用场景 NetACC适用于网络开销...
框架设计 扩展点加载 实现细节 SPI扩展实现 协议扩展 调用拦截扩展 引用监听扩展 暴露监听扩展 集群扩展 路由扩展 负载均衡扩展 合并结果扩展 注册中心扩展 监控中心扩展 扩展点加载扩展 动态代理扩展 编译器扩展 消息派发扩展 线程池扩展 ...
以及处理消息线程池核心/最大线程数大小 threadPoolQueueSize false Integer 线程池队列大小,会影响消息处理线程池队列和发送消息线程池队列大小 optimalNetworkLinkOption false OptimalNetworkLinkOption 链路优选配置参数项 ...
在容器服务K8s集群或Serverless K8s集群中创建或部署应用时,您可以通过Java启动参数对JVM进行内存、GC(垃圾回收)策略以及服务注册与发现等配置。正确配置Java启动参数有助于降低GC(垃圾回收)开销,从而缩短服务器响应时间并提高吞吐量...
初始的线程池处理来自云端或边缘应用对设备的请求调用,具体大小可根据接入设备量进行合理设置。leda_register_and_online_by_device_name 和 leda_register_and_online_by_local_name 有什么区别?答:by_device_name 表示用此接口实现...